ASEAN Pavilion at Osaka, Japan by Beatrice Goh is a detailed study of architectural space and design on paper. Beatrice uses layered lines and colour to capture the pavilion’s structure and atmosphere. Inspired by the pavilion’s form and cultural significance, her work transforms the scene into a rich, immersive experience—where architecture, perspective, and pattern come together in intricate detail.
Medium: Mixed media on paper
Size: 42cm (height) x 60cm (width) each

About Beatrice Goh
As an energetic youth, Beatrice's mother encouraged her to draw as a way to build focus and concentration. This early introduction to art sparked a growing passion that led her to join ART:DIS in 2017, where she continues to develop her artistic style. Beatrice’s works often portray people of different nationalities, reflecting her appreciation for cultural diversity. She once dreamed of becoming an air stewardess to meet people from around the world—a desire that lives on in her art, which envisions a harmonious and inclusive world.
